Detail: The year 2012 marks Paik’s 41st year serving the Madison community. Originally started by Grandmaster Sang Kee Paik, the program is based on the flowing, circular, and absorbing motions of Chuan Fa blended with Taekwondo style kicking and the linear, direct style of Karate—all of which Grandmaster Sang Kee Paik mastered in Korea. In 1996, Grandmaster Sang Kee Paik’s son, Master Peter Paik assumed full time operation of the program. Since then the program has produced over 30 national champions in Karate and Taekwondo.
